Meaning
Servant Of The Creator
The name Amatul-Khaliq has a beautiful literal meaning, which is 'servant of the Creator'. This name carries a deep emotional depth, as it signifies a strong connection with the divine. The word 'Amatul' means 'servant' or 'maid', and 'Khaliq' means 'the Creator'. In Arabic, the name Amatul-Khaliq is written with a sense of humility and devotion, reflecting the individual's commitment to their faith.
